14:22 — Heads up for anyone new: this is where things got weird. The Copperdial rotation utility kicked off its scheduled run but grabbed a stale vault lease, so half the Ferncastle services got fresh credentials while the other half kept the old ones. Auth errors spiked for about nine minutes before Priya's team paused the rotation and replayed it with a forced lease refresh. The replay job that fixed things is referenced by the token below.

session token of bawep-yadup = htk21_528abd376e3c5a4ec24a1

## Troubleshooting: Donation-Receipt Mailer Duplicates

When the Givewell-Orchard mailer sends duplicate receipts, the usual cause is a retried webhook arriving after the idempotency record expired. Reviewer note: the dedupe window is configurable and should never drop below one hour. Verify the queue consumer acknowledges only after persistence. Replay suspect events against staging using the bearer token below.

session JWT of tadup-kaguf = eyJhbGciOiJIUzI1NiIsInR5cCI6IkpXVCJ9.eyJzdWIiOiItNz4V3In0.KrZCeqpk

Visiting contractors requiring after-hours access to the server room at Dunmere Court must be pre-registered with the Facilities team before 16:00 on the day of the visit. Access is permitted between 19:00 and 06:00 only, and contractors must sign the after-hours log at the night desk on arrival and departure. Tools and equipment are subject to inspection. Escorts are not provided after 21:00, so contractors should plan accordingly. Entry to the server room corridor is granted using the code below.

turnstile pass: bdg-YPPQB-52010